Description
Aru is just getting the hang of this whole Pandava thing when the Otherworld goes into full panic mode. The god of love's bow and arrow have gone missing, and the thief isn't playing Cupid. If that weren't bad enough, Aru gets framed as the thief. If she doesn't find the arrow by the next full moon, she'll be kicked out of the Otherworld. For good.

About the Author
Roshani Chokshi
Roshani Chokshi is an American children's book author and a New York Times bestselling author.
